No, you're not nuts.  Just about anything can be a symptom of a panic attack.  Panic is a physiological response and can mess with the digestive system, for example, explaining the gas.  You should consider going back to your doctor and asking if you should change or adjust your medication.  Therapy might be a good idea, too, if you're not already in it.
